Meaning of seesaw
- A play among children in which they are seated upon the opposite ends of a plank which is balanced in the middle, and move alternately up and down.
- A plank or board adjusted for this play.
- A vibratory or reciprocating motion.
- Same as Crossruff.
- To move with a reciprocating motion; to move backward and forward, or upward and downward.
- To cause to move backward and forward in seesaw fashion.
- Moving up and down, or to and fro; having a reciprocating motion.
